Columbus bar patrons were blessed with the grand openings of many new places all across the city, ranging from dive bars and watering holes to upscale lounges with fancy cocktail menus. Our readers voted the Oddfellows Liquor Bar in the Short North as their favorite new addition to the drinking scene, thanks to its accessible prices, hip location, and the “doesn’t-take-itself-too-seriously” atmosphere that carries over from the owners’ other venture: Late Night Slice.
Opened in August at 1038 High Street, Oddfellows is one part hipster, one part history, paying homage to the historic Independent Order of the Oddfellows building where it resides, while decorating the space with knick-knacks that look like they could have been acquired during the closure of Betty’s down the street. Oddfellows also got a food upgrade in October when Katalina’s launched a “brunch and munch” pop-up there that serves up their renditions of bar food Thursdays through Sundays.
